What is the Podcast About?
Sessions and Lessons: Unscripted is a self-improvement podcast that blends meaningful reflection with everyday humor, creating a space where personal growth feels accessible instead of intimidating. Hosted by Joel and Gloria Rosario, the show explores the challenges, habits, insecurities, and experiences that shape modern life. Rather than presenting themselves as experts with all the answers, the hosts approach each topic with curiosity and honesty, inviting listeners into conversations that feel more like sitting with trusted friends than attending a motivational seminar. From mindfulness and self-awareness to relationships, nostalgia, mental health, and personal identity, the podcast covers a wide range of subjects while maintaining an approachable and conversational tone.
What makes the show stand out is its ability to balance thoughtful discussion with lighthearted storytelling. Joel and Gloria often use personal experiences, cultural references, and everyday situations to examine deeper questions about growth and fulfillment. Episodes move naturally between humor and introspection, allowing listeners to reflect on serious topics without feeling overwhelmed. Whether they are discussing the evolution of mental health conversations, revisiting memories from past decades, or exploring the uncomfortable truths behind self-improvement, the podcast encourages listeners to embrace progress without demanding perfection.

Core Theme
At its heart, Sessions and Lessons: Unscripted is about embracing growth without pretending to have everything figured out. The podcast challenges the idea that self-improvement must always be polished, structured, or perfectly executed. Instead, Joel and Gloria highlight the reality that meaningful change often emerges from mistakes, uncomfortable conversations, self-reflection, and a willingness to examine our own habits and assumptions. Their discussions frequently remind listeners that growth is rarely linear and that progress often begins with acknowledging imperfections rather than hiding them.
Another major theme throughout the podcast is the relationship between personal history and present identity. Through conversations about music, childhood memories, generational differences, mental health, and cultural experiences, the hosts explore how our past continues to influence our choices and beliefs. By connecting nostalgia with self-discovery, the show encourages listeners to better understand themselves while remaining open to change. This combination of reflection and forward movement gives the podcast both emotional depth and practical relevance.
